Hinge joints are designed to allow movement in one specific plane, resembling the mechanism of a door hinge. This unique structure, formed by articular surfaces that fit together in a way that restricts movement, ensures stability and efficient load-bearing in activities like walking and lifting. The unidirectional bending minimizes the risk of injuries, as it limits excessive motion that could lead to dislocation or strain. Overall, this design optimizes both functionality and safety in joint movement.
